In With the Old, In With the New: The Unique Recruiting Challenge the US Government is Facing

Linkedin Talent Blog

Throughout the country, state and local agencies are facing an exodus of senior workers who are retiring en masse. "In our department alone, we could lose anywhere between 17 to 20 percent of our workforce today — folks that could leave," says Alby Bocanegra , a recruiting manager for the City and County of San Francisco. . .
